What Affects Solar Panel Cost in Oro Valley?
Understanding what drives solar panel costs helps you make a smarter buying decision in Oro Valley, Arizona.
1. Project Size & Scope
Larger projects cost more in materials and labor time. Small jobs in Oro Valley can start as low as $13,841, while large-scale projects reach $54,884.
2. Materials & Quality Tier
Budget materials save 20–30% upfront but may need replacement sooner. Premium options cost more initially but offer longer warranties and better performance in Arizona.
3. Oro Valley Labor Rates
Labor makes up 30–45% of total cost. BLS data shows contractor wages in Arizona average $45/hr. Oro Valley rates may run 10–20% above the state average.
4. Permits & Inspections
A permit is required for most solar panel projects in Oro Valley. Permit costs typically run $75–$500. Always use a licensed contractor who pulls the permit — unpermitted work can void your insurance.
5. Contractor Experience
Licensed, insured contractors in Oro Valley charge more than unlicensed ones — but protect you legally. Always verify the Arizona contractor license before signing.
6. Timing & Season
Peak season demand in Arizona can raise prices 15–25%. Off-peak booking (late fall, winter for outdoor work) often yields better rates and faster scheduling from top contractors.
